Transaction 52c67808abe9198cd7b26fddf4cecd762bc96d61fe5e9f73fc90152556f9ae4e

block
81b59c6bfc7c352fb9848aa7a321f947f7eb4ac57ba2b0478151a9c1085ba5eb

1 Input

2 Outputs